+From: Russ Allbery <rra@cpan.org>
+Date: Sat, 11 Jun 2022 16:33:06 -0700
+Subject: Fix t/spin/errors with Perl 5.36
+
+The Text::Balanced in Perl 5.36 uses a different default regex for
+extracting text, which changes the error output. Adjust for that
+in the test suite.
